Definition
  1. Noun:
    • A primitive dinosaur found in Brazil: "Staurikosaurus" is the name of a genus of small, early theropod dinosaurs whose fossils have been discovered in Brazil. It lived during the Late Triassic period.

Advanced Usage
  • Scientific Classification: The name "Staurikosaurus" is used in formal taxonomic and paleontological contexts. It is often discussed in relation to other early dinosaurs like Herrerasaurus.
    • The phylogenetic position of Staurikosaurus is crucial for mapping the early diversification of dinosaurs.
Variants and Related Words
  • Staurikosauridae (n): The proposed family name that may include Staurikosaurus and its closest relatives.
    • Some classifications place the genus within the family Staurikosauridae.
